Subject: [PATCH v5 4/9] dt-bindings: reset: add sama7g5 definitions
Date: Fri, 10 Jun 2022 12:24:09 +0300	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20220610092414.1816571-5-claudiu.beznea@microchip.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20220610092414.1816571-1-claudiu.beznea@microchip.com>

Add reset bindings for SAMA7G5. At the moment only USB PHYs are
included.

Signed-off-by: Claudiu Beznea <claudiu.beznea@microchip.com>
Acked-by: Philipp Zabel <p.zabel@pengutronix.de>
Acked-by: Rob Herring <robh@kernel.org>
---
 include/dt-bindings/reset/sama7g5-reset.h | 10 ++++++++++
 1 file changed, 10 insertions(+)
 create mode 100644 include/dt-bindings/reset/sama7g5-reset.h

diff --git a/include/dt-bindings/reset/sama7g5-reset.h b/include/dt-bindings/reset/sama7g5-reset.h
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..2116f41d04e0
--- /dev/null
+++ b/include/dt-bindings/reset/sama7g5-reset.h
@@ -0,0 +1,10 @@
+/* SPDX-License-Identifier: (GPL-2.0-only OR BSD-2-Clause) */
+
+#ifndef __DT_BINDINGS_RESET_SAMA7G5_H
+#define __DT_BINDINGS_RESET_SAMA7G5_H
+
+#define SAMA7G5_RESET_USB_PHY1		4
+#define SAMA7G5_RESET_USB_PHY2		5
+#define SAMA7G5_RESET_USB_PHY3		6
+
+#endif /* __DT_BINDINGS_RESET_SAMA7G5_H */
